- Is Cincinnati Birth Center a freestanding birth center or a hospital unit?
- Cincinnati Birth Center is a freestanding birth center — a facility separate from a hospital. Freestanding birth centers typically serve low-risk pregnancies and have a hospital-transfer plan in place; ask Cincinnati Birth Center about theirs, and confirm with your provider that a birth-center birth fits your situation.
